Half life period of the first order reaction depends upon:

Correct answer: B. Temperature

  • A. Initial concentration
  • B. Temperature
  • C. Catalyst
  • D. All of above

Explanation

1st order reactionHalf life time - t1/2 = 0.693/kK = rate constantK is dependent on temperature So, t1/2 is also dependent on temperature.

About Reaction Kinetics

Reaction kinetics relates reaction rate to concentration, temperature, surface area and catalysts. Questions cover rate laws, reaction order, rate constants, activation energy and the activated complex, including how a catalyst lowers the activation energy without changing the overall energy change or equilibrium position.
